... a device for setting a fishing net under the ice between two ice holes ... 2, record 1, English, - prairie%20ice%20jigger
Record number: 1, Textual support number: 1 CONT
A jigger consists of a board and two levers so arranged that a backward pull on a line attached to one lever is translated into a forward thrust which propels the board along beneath the ice. 4, record 1, English, - prairie%20ice%20jigger
Record number: 1, Textual support number: 2 CONT
Another method uses a prairie ice jigger, a sledlike wooden device that slides along the underside of the ice. The jigger is launched under the ice, towing a rope. When the rope is pulled, a lever is raised; when the rope is released, the lever springs back in such a way that it pushes against the ice and jerks the jigger forward. 5, record 1, English, - prairie%20ice%20jigger

Une autre méthode consiste à se servir d'une navette, petit instrument de bois en forme de traîneau qu'on glisse le long de la surface inférieure de la glace. Sous la glace, la navette traîne une corde derrière elle et, lorsqu'on tire sur la corde, un levier se redresse; au moment où la corde est relâchée, le levier se rabat de telle sorte qu'il s'appuie contre la glace et pousse la navette vers l'avant. 1, record 1, French, - navette
